Anna Ware is an accredited Life Coach, a qualified primary school teacher, and a Neuro-Linguistic Programming (NLP) Practitioner.

My journey into coaching anxious kids began when I enrolled in a “Life Coach and NLP Practitioner” course out of my personal interest in self-development. Driven by my love for psychology and working with kids, I was utterly astonished and deeply moved by how effective NLP is in tackling mental health challenges, especially in helping children break free from long-standing anxiety. The profound impact it had on me was a powerful catalyst, inspiring me to start my own kids’ coaching practice.

My passion for coaching children through NLP comes from a deep desire to help those who feel stuck in life. I’m especially driven to support kids weighed down by anxiety, helping them find their way towards a life full of meaning, hope, and confidence. There’s nothing more rewarding than watching that transformation unfold and knowing I’ve been a part of their journey.

It hasn’t always been easy, though. I often feel frustrated by how little-known NLP is, despite its incredible effectiveness. The lack of financial support for alternative therapies like NLP is disheartening, as it suggests that mainstream health methods are the only option.

My approach is highly personalised, with one-on-one coaching sessions tailored to each child and their family, aiming to eliminate anxiety and create a calmer mindset. With a background in teaching, I connect well with kids, and my passion for the mind and personal development shapes everything I do.
